In our discussion today, Mark and I (your host, Neil Binkley) talk about:

What do photography agents do for their photographers, and vice versa?
How does the Gren Group stay in touch with ad agencies?
How art producers reacted to the Gren Group’s change in focus
What happens when things don’t work out between a rep and a photographer on their roster
How can you build relationships with clients, instead of blindly marketing to them?
How should you negotiate licensing and budgets?
How important is motion work to ad agencies and reps these days?
Is “authenticity” a fleeting trend in Lifestyle photography?
How should you approach an agent? (Mark also wrote a blog post about it)
Where he invests his efforts in social media
